NOGUEIRA, Nilcemar; ANDRADE, Regina Glória Nunes and VASQUEZ, Georgie Echeverri. African ancestry of samba culture and identity. Rev. Subj. [online]. 2016, vol.16, n.1, pp. 166-180. ISSN 2359-0769. http://dx.doi.org/10.5020/23590777.16.1.166-180.
The article deals with the process of configuring the black identities of the peoples of the African diaspora in Brazil, highlighting the places and contexts of emergence and the development of blackness as a concept. From this socio historical perspective, it makes reference to the construction of the Brazilian national identity pointing to the hybridization as tangible cultural phenomenon in the musical traditions. In this line of preservation of traditions, the text finally shows how samba in Rio was registered as intangible cultural heritage of Brazil, under the leadership of the Cartola Cultural Center, today the Samba Museum.
